Abstract
The invention discloses a kind of livestock-raising cattle and sheep to give up automatic cleaning apparatus, its structure includes drinking trough support leg, drainage pipeline, drinking-water groove body, product nameplate, Clean Brush for cleaning, automatic heating device, drinking trough rollover stand, hairbrush driver, water inlet line, the present invention realizes livestock-raising cattle and sheep and gives up automatic cleaning apparatus by being equipped with automatic heating device, even device is when using in winter or the lower weather of temperature, water in device can be carried out being heated to the suitable temperature of poultry, the water in drinking trough is avoided to freeze, ensure poultry drinking-water health, reduce aquaculture cost, improve the income of cultivation.

Advantageous effect
A kind of livestock-raising cattle and sheep of the present invention give up automatic cleaning apparatus, in order to solve in winter or the lower weather of temperature
When, the water capacity easy freezing in automatic cleaning apparatus, preventing the direct Chilled Drinking Water of poultry from will appear indigestion leads to aquaculture cost
Increase, when drink coolant-temperature gage it is relatively low when, temperature-detecting device open heater power source structure, drink is made by heater power source structure
Hot-water heating system is started to work, and is heated to the drinking water in livestock-raising cattle and sheep house automatic cleaning apparatus, is ensured poultry drink
Water health, graphene film at the top of heater housing can be by the temperature conductions of drinking water to thermometer bulb, the working substance inside thermometer bulb
Matter reduces pressure since temperature reduces, and pressure is passed to by capillary in bourdon tube, and bourdon tube deforms upon contraction, is stuck up at this time
As bourdon tube contraction is moved to the left at the top of plate body, wraping plate bottom part body moves right, and pulley connecting rod drives the second fixed pulley
It rotates clockwise, the second fixed pulley drives the first driving cam synchronous rotary, the first driving cam and first by driving belt
Fixed pulley is close together, and the first fixed pulley drives button drive rod to squeeze flat spring and transported downwards along drive rod fixing axle
Dynamic, button drive rod opens the switch button of heating stick controller upper surface, and heating stick controller makes to make heating by electrical conduction
Stick main body is started to work, and is heated to the drinking water in equipment, and when equipment carries out automated cleaning, the sewage in equipment passes through
Drainage pipeline is discharged, and the water level decreasing drunk water in groove body at this time, water level detecting floating ball is moved down with water level, water level detecting
The floating ball rod of floating ball right end is rotated counterclockwise using connecting rod fixed block as the center of circle, and the first transmission gear of floating ball rod right end drives
Gear-driving rod moves down in reversing frame fixed seat, the metal memory spring drops down on gear-driving rod, and gear passes
Lever is snapped together with revolution frame body, and revolution frame body rotates counterclockwise in reversing frame fixed seat, and revolution frame body is right
The power supply push rod at end moves up, and helical spring flicks upwards at this time, moves movable contact terminal and stationary contact terminals point on iron plate
From heating rod main body is stopped at this time, and equipment is avoided not have water to carry out dry combustion method.
The present invention realizes livestock-raising cattle and sheep and gives up automatic cleaning apparatus by being equipped with automatic heating device, even if device
It is in winter or the lower weather of temperature in use, can carry out being heated to the suitable temperature of poultry to the water in device, avoids
Water in drinking trough freezes, and ensures poultry drinking-water health, reduces aquaculture cost, improve the income of cultivation.
